pecl#12794, pecl#12401 # Running the tests: # (Note: Doesn't work currnetly on HEAD, see: # http://news.php.net/php.qa/64378) # # PDO_MYSQL_TEST_DSN - DSN # For example: mysql:dbname=test;host=localhost;port=3306 # # PDO_MYSQL_TEST_HOST - database host # PDO_MYSQL_TEST_DB - database (schema) name # PDO_MYSQL_TEST_SOCKET - database server socket # PDO_MYSQL_TEST_ENGINE - storage engine to use # PDO_MYSQL_TEST_USER - database user # PDO_MYSQL_TEST_PASS - database user password # PDO_MYSQL_TEST_CHARSET - database charset # # NOTE: if any of PDO_MYSQL_TEST_[HOST|DB|SOCKET|ENGINE|CHARSET] is # part of PDO_MYSQL_TEST_DSN, the values must match. That is, for example, # for PDO_MYSQL_TEST_DSN = mysql:dbname=test you MUST set PDO_MYSQL_TEST_DB=test.

/*
|
|
NOTE - this will cause an error and it OK
|
|
When using unbuffered prepared statements MySQL expects you to
|
|
fetch all data from the row before sending new data to the server.
|
|
PDO::query() will prepare and execute a statement in one step.
|
|
After the execution of PDO::query(), MySQL expects you to fetch
|
|
the results from the line before sending new commands. However,
|
|
PHP/PDO will send a CLOSE message as part of the PDO::query() call.
|
|
|
|
The following happens:
|
|
|
|
$stmt = PDO::query(<some query>)
|
|
mysql_stmt_prepare()
|
|
mysql_stmt_execute()
|
|
|
|
$stmt->fetchAll()
|
|
mysql_stmt_fetch()
|
|
|
|
And now the right side of the expression will be executed first:
|
|
$stmt = PDO::query(<some query>)
|
|
PDO::query(<some query>)
|
|
mysql_stmt_prepare
|
|
mysql_stmt_execute
|
|
|
|
PHP continues at the left side of the expression:
|
|
|
|
$stmt = PDO::query(<some query>)
|
|
|
|
What happens is that $stmt gets overwritten. The reference counter of the
|
|
zval representing the current value of $stmt. PDO gets a callback that
|
|
it has to free the resources associated with the zval representing the
|
|
current value of stmt:
|
|
mysql_stmt_close
|
|
---> ERROR
|
|
---> execute() has been send on the line, you are supposed to fetch
|
|
---> you must not try to send a CLOSE after execute()
|
|
---> Error: 2050 (CR_FETCH_CANCELED)
|
|
---> Message: Row retrieval was canceled by mysql_stmt_close() call
|
|
---> MySQL does its best to recover the line and cancels the retrieval
|
|
|
|
PHP proceeds and assigns the new statement object/zval obtained from
|
|
PDO to $stmt.
|
|
|
|
Solutions:
|
|
- use mysqlnd
|
|
- use prepare() + execute() instead of query()
|
|
- as there is no explicit close() in PDO, try unset($stmt) before the new assignment
|
|
- fix PDO::query() [not the driver, fix PDO itself]
|
|
*/
